Anterior cruciate ligament (ACL) reconstruction surgery is a common orthopedic procedure aimed at repairing a torn ACL, one of the key ligaments that helps stabilize the knee joint. The ACL plays a crucial role in facilitating the proper movement of the knee during activities that involve pivoting and sudden changes in direction, thereby making it essential for athletes and active individuals. When the ACL is injured, either through a traumatic event, such as a sports-related injury or through degeneration, it can lead to instability, swelling, and pain in the knee. The surgical procedure typically begins with a detailed pre-operative assessment, including an MRI to confirm the extent of the damage, followed by the selection of an appropriate graft material to be used for reconstruction. Grafts can be sourced from the patient's own body, known as autografts-commonly taken from the patellar tendon, hamstring tendon, or quadriceps tendon-or from a donor, referred to as allografts. The choice of graft largely depends on factors such as the patient's age, activity level, and surgeon's preference. During the surgery, usually performed arthroscopically, small incisions are made around the knee, allowing the surgeon to insert tiny cameras and instruments needed to visualize and repair the damaged ligament. The torn remnants of the ACL are removed, and the chosen graft is then positioned to replicate the natural anatomy of the ligament. Fixation of the graft at both ends is achieved using screws or other fixation devices, ensuring stability and promoting healing. Post-operative recovery is structured around a tailored rehabilitation program that focuses on restoring range of motion, strength, and function to the knee. Rehabilitation typically begins with gentle movements to prevent stiffness and progresses to strengthening exercises and eventually sport-specific training, varying in duration based on the individual's progress and activity level. Full recovery can take anywhere from six months to a year, and the success of the surgery is often gauged by the patient's return to pre-injury activity levels and satisfaction with knee function. Risks associated with ACL reconstruction include infection, blood clots, persistent pain, and complications related to graft integrity. However, when conducted by an experienced orthopedic surgeon, the success rates are generally high, offering patients the opportunity to return to their previous activities and improve their quality of life. Overall, ACL reconstruction is a vital intervention for those looking to regain knee stability and return to an active lifestyle, significantly reducing the risks of further injury and promoting long-term joint health. The combination of surgical expertise and comprehensive rehabilitation is essential for achieving optimal outcomes in this population.
